The cheapest way to get from Dublin Ferryport Terminals to Londonderry is to bus via The Gresham Hotel which costs £20 - £28 and takes 6h 10m.
The fastest way to get from Dublin Ferryport Terminals to Londonderry is to drive which takes 2h 53m and costs £35 - £55.
No, there is no direct bus from Dublin Ferryport Terminals to Londonderry station. However, there are services departing from Vernon Court and arriving at Derry Londonderry Bus Station via Dublin Busaras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 27m.
The distance between Dublin Ferryport Terminals and Londonderry is 210 miles. The road distance is 142.9 miles.
The best way to get from Dublin Ferryport Terminals to Londonderry without a car is to train which takes 5h 26m and costs £30 - £50.
It takes approximately 5h 26m to get from Dublin Ferryport Terminals to Londonderry, including transfers.
Dublin Ferryport Terminals to Londonderry bus services, operated by Translink, depart from Dublin Busaras Bus Station.
The best way to get from Dublin Ferryport Terminals to Londonderry is to train which takes 5h 26m and costs £30 - £50.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s and takes 5h 27m.
Dublin Ferryport Terminals to Londonderry bus services, operated by Translink, arrive at Derry Londonderry Bus Station.
Yes, the driving distance between Dublin Ferryport Terminals to Londonderry is 143 miles. It takes approximately 2h 53m to drive from Dublin Ferryport Terminals to Londonderry.
